Pricing Plans
| Plan | Fly.io | Railway |
|---|---|---|
| Free Plan | ❌ No | ✅ Yes |
| Shared CPU Machine | $2.02/mo | $5/mo |
| Standard Support | $29/mo | $20/mo |
| Enterprise | Custom | Custom |

Pros & Cons
Fly.io
✅ Pros
- Deploy to 30+ regions for low-latency globally
- Run any Docker container without locking into one framework
- Real Machines API for custom orchestration
- SQLite on Fly (LiteFS) for edge-native databases
❌ Cons
- Steeper learning curve than Vercel/Render
- CLI-centric workflow can frustrate dashboard users
- Billing can be unpredictable with usage-based model
Railway
✅ Pros
- Deploy anything — Docker, Node, Python, Go, Rust, databases
- One-click PostgreSQL, Redis, MySQL provisioning
- Usage-based pricing — only pay for what you use
- Beautiful dashboard and dead-simple DX
- Built-in private networking between services
❌ Cons
- Free plan is for experimentation; paid usage should be modeled before production
- No serverless functions (everything is container-based)
- Can get expensive for high-traffic apps
- Limited regions compared to AWS/GCP
- No built-in CDN — need Cloudflare in front
